/*
|
|
from BACnet SSPC-135-2004
|
|
|
|
14. FILE ACCESS SERVICES
|
|
|
|
This clause defines the set of services used to access and
|
|
manipulate files contained in BACnet devices. The concept of files
|
|
is used here as a network-visible representation for a collection
|
|
of octets of arbitrary length and meaning. This is an abstract
|
|
concept only and does not imply the use of disk, tape or other
|
|
mass storage devices in the server devices. These services may
|
|
be used to access vendor-defined files as well as specific
|
|
files defined in the BACnet protocol standard.
|
|
Every file that is accessible by File Access Services shall
|
|
have a corresponding File object in the BACnet device. This File
|
|
object is used to identify the particular file by name. In addition,
|
|
the File object provides access to "header information," such
|
|
as the file's total size, creation date, and type. File Access
|
|
Services may model files in two ways: as a continuous stream of
|
|
octets or as a contiguous sequence of numbered records.
|
|
The File Access Services provide atomic read and write operations.
|
|
In this context "atomic" means that during the execution
|
|
of a read or write operation, no other AtomicReadFile or
|
|
AtomicWriteFile operations are allowed for the same file.
|
|
Synchronization of these services with internal operations
|
|
of the BACnet device is a local matter and is not defined by this
|
|
standard.
|
|
|
|
14.1 AtomicReadFile Service
|
|
|
|
14.1.5 Service Procedure
|
|
|
|
The responding BACnet-user shall first verify the validity
|
|
of the 'File Identifier' parameter and return a 'Result(-)' response
|
|
with the appropriate error class and code if the File object
|
|
is unknown, if there is currently another AtomicReadFile or
|
|
AtomicWriteFile service in progress, or if the File object is
|
|
currently inaccessible for another reason. If the 'File Start
|
|
Position' parameter or the 'File Start Record' parameter is
|
|
either less than 0 or exceeds the actual file size, then the appropriate
|
|
error is returned in a 'Result(-)' response. If not, then the
|
|
responding BACnet-user shall read the number of octets specified by
|
|
'Requested Octet Count' or the number of records specified by
|
|
'Requested Record Count'. If the number of remaining octets or
|
|
records is less than the requested amount, then the length of
|
|
the 'File Data' returned or 'Returned Record Count' shall indicate
|
|
the actual number read. If the returned response contains the
|
|
last octet or record of the file, then the 'End Of File' parameter
|
|
shall be TRUE, otherwise FALSE.
|
|
*/

#if defined(BACFILE)
|
|
void handler_atomic_read_file(
|
|
uint8_t * service_request,
|
|
uint16_t service_len,
|
|
BACNET_ADDRESS * src,
|
|
BACNET_CONFIRMED_SERVICE_DATA * service_data)
|
|
{
|
|
BACNET_ATOMIC_READ_FILE_DATA data;
|
|
int len = 0;
|
|
int pdu_len = 0;
|
|
bool error = false;
|
|
int bytes_sent = 0;
|
|
BACNET_NPDU_DATA npdu_data;
|
|
BACNET_ADDRESS my_address;
|
|
BACNET_ERROR_CLASS error_class = ERROR_CLASS_OBJECT;
|
|
BACNET_ERROR_CODE error_code = ERROR_CODE_UNKNOWN_OBJECT;
|
|
|
|
#if PRINT_ENABLED
|
|
fprintf(stderr, "Received Atomic-Read-File Request!\n");
|
|
#endif
|
|
/* encode the NPDU portion of the packet */
|
|
datalink_get_my_address(&my_address);
|
|
npdu_encode_npdu_data(&npdu_data, false, MESSAGE_PRIORITY_NORMAL);
|
|
pdu_len =
|
|
npdu_encode_pdu(&Handler_Transmit_Buffer[0], src, &my_address,
|
|
&npdu_data);
|
|
if (service_data->segmented_message) {
|
|
len =
|
|
abort_encode_apdu(&Handler_Transmit_Buffer[pdu_len],
|
|
service_data->invoke_id, ABORT_REASON_SEGMENTATION_NOT_SUPPORTED,
|
|
true);
|
|
#if PRINT_ENABLED
|
|
fprintf(stderr, "ARF: Segmented Message. Sending Abort!\n");
|
|
#endif
|
|
goto ARF_ABORT;
|
|
}
|
|
len = arf_decode_service_request(service_request, service_len, &data);
|
|
/* bad decoding - send an abort */
|
|
if (len < 0) {
|
|
len =
|
|
abort_encode_apdu(&Handler_Transmit_Buffer[pdu_len],
|
|
service_data->invoke_id, ABORT_REASON_OTHER, true);
|
|
#if PRINT_ENABLED
|
|
fprintf(stderr, "Bad Encoding. Sending Abort!\n");
|
|
#endif
|
|
goto ARF_ABORT;
|
|
}
|
|
if (data.object_type == OBJECT_FILE) {
|
|
if (!bacfile_valid_instance(data.object_instance)) {
|
|
error = true;
|
|
} else if (data.access == FILE_STREAM_ACCESS) {
|
|
if (data.type.stream.requestedOctetCount <
|
|
octetstring_capacity(&data.fileData[0])) {
|
|
bacfile_read_stream_data(&data);
|
|
#if PRINT_ENABLED
|
|
fprintf(stderr, "ARF: Stream offset %d, %d octets.\n",
|
|
data.type.stream.fileStartPosition,
|
|
data.type.stream.requestedOctetCount);
|
|
#endif
|
|
len =
|
|
arf_ack_encode_apdu(&Handler_Transmit_Buffer[pdu_len],
|
|
service_data->invoke_id, &data);
|
|
} else {
|
|
len =
|
|
abort_encode_apdu(&Handler_Transmit_Buffer[pdu_len],
|
|
service_data->invoke_id,
|
|
ABORT_REASON_SEGMENTATION_NOT_SUPPORTED, true);
|
|
#if PRINT_ENABLED
|
|
fprintf(stderr, "Too Big To Send (%d >= %d). Sending Abort!\n",
|
|
data.type.stream.requestedOctetCount,
|
|
(int)octetstring_capacity(&data.fileData[0]));
|
|
#endif
|
|
}
|
|
} else if (data.access == FILE_RECORD_ACCESS) {
|
|
if (data.type.record.fileStartRecord >=
|
|
BACNET_READ_FILE_RECORD_COUNT) {
|
|
error_class = ERROR_CLASS_SERVICES;
|
|
error_code = ERROR_CODE_INVALID_FILE_START_POSITION;
|
|
error = true;
|
|
} else if (bacfile_read_stream_data(&data)) {
|
|
#if PRINT_ENABLED
|
|
fprintf(stderr, "ARF: fileStartRecord %d, %u RecordCount.\n",
|
|
data.type.record.fileStartRecord,
|
|
data.type.record.RecordCount);
|
|
#endif
|
|
len =
|
|
arf_ack_encode_apdu(&Handler_Transmit_Buffer[pdu_len],
|
|
service_data->invoke_id, &data);
|
|
} else {
|
|
error = true;
|
|
error_class = ERROR_CLASS_OBJECT;
|
|
error_code = ERROR_CODE_FILE_ACCESS_DENIED;
|
|
}
|
|
} else {
|
|
error = true;
|
|
error_class = ERROR_CLASS_SERVICES;
|
|
error_code = ERROR_CODE_INVALID_FILE_ACCESS_METHOD;
|
|
#if PRINT_ENABLED
|
|
fprintf(stderr, "Record Access Requested. Sending Error!\n");
|
|
#endif
|
|
}
|
|
} else {
|
|
error = true;
|
|
error_class = ERROR_CLASS_SERVICES;
|
|
error_code = ERROR_CODE_INCONSISTENT_OBJECT_TYPE;
|
|
}
|
|
if (error) {
|
|
len =
|
|
bacerror_encode_apdu(&Handler_Transmit_Buffer[pdu_len],
|
|
service_data->invoke_id, SERVICE_CONFIRMED_ATOMIC_READ_FILE,
|
|
error_class, error_code);
|
|
}
|
|
ARF_ABORT:
|
|
pdu_len += len;
|
|
bytes_sent =
|
|
datalink_send_pdu(src, &npdu_data, &Handler_Transmit_Buffer[0],
|
|
pdu_len);
|
|
#if PRINT_ENABLED
|
|
if (bytes_sent <= 0) {
|
|
fprintf(stderr, "Failed to send PDU (%s)!\n", strerror(errno));
|
|
}
|
|
#endif
|
|
|
|
return;
|
|
}
|
|
#endif
